Curtis T.

This is the only classic diner, featuring barstool counter seating you will find anywhere close to the area, and it delivers exactly what you would expect - entertainment from skilled short order cooks, decent hot coffee, efficient and friendly service, and scrumptious food. What I ate: - eggs, sausage, hashbrowns, toast: (4/5) Very tasty! Crispy, hot hashbrowns. Perfectly cooked over easy eggs, decent sausage. Toast made for jam. - pancake: (4/5) hot, fluffy and just what you would expect! Check them out!

Jim N.

I just relocated back to St. Louis and loved Spencer's Grill for many years! HOWEVER, when I walked in for breakfast the first time in years, I left very disappointed. 7:00AM I counted 12 patrons. and 5 waiters. Every one of the waiters where texting on their cell phones. They looked at me as I seated myself. I waited, interrupted the texting and asked for a menu. One of them handed it to me and walked away. I then asked for coffee. I waited....Interrupted the texting again and asked if I could place my order. The young man took my order and went back to texting with the other four waiters. First, they brought out my eggs and cold bacon.. Later they brough out my toast that was cold, Third, they brough out hash browns hot but uncooked. I interrupted the boys again and asked for my bill. I paid it and walked out very disappointed. Too bad, I used to love this place.
